Security - Community Update

As salam 'alaikum wa rahamatullahi wa barakaatuhu, My dear brothers and sisters of the Calgary Muslim community. These are indeed very trying times for the Ummah, especially after the driving rampage incident outside Finsbury Mosque in London. It is imperative that we do our due diligence in remaining safe. The IISC has placed CCTV cameras in the front and rear of the Masjid, and has hired security to be on site during peak hours. We would like to remind our sisters particularly to be cautious and not walk alone especially at night. All Muslims should be vigilant of anything suspicious taking place in or out of the masaajid. If you see anything suspicious please call the police to keep them informed and tell someone from the administration. It is better to be on the side of caution and be wrong than to allow an atrocity to take place.
